Last week we started a month-long series on Malachi. And we saw that God was concerned about the indifference His people were feeling and demonstrating towards Him. They were practically living in what they imagined as neutral ground in relation to God. So what’s to be done when we feel this way about God? In verse 2 of chapter 1, God reminded His people that: “I have loved you.”
These week as we continue to look at this disease of indifference and God’s solution as we look at Malachi 1:6-2:9. We’re going to get the chance to listen in to what God has to say to the Christian leaders and see how this disease of indifference was playing out in the religious lives of the people.
